What Could Sudden Intense Arm Pain In An Overweight Person With High BP Mean?

i woke up this am and was getting ready for work and had a pain go down my right arm felt like something passing threw my veins i was screaming in pain i thought i was gonna pass out then in about 5 minutes it went away and i went to work i have high blood pressure and am overweight and on blood thinner

Hello dear,

Given the history that you have high blood pressure, overweight & on blood thinner, the symptoms as mentioned in your post can be attributed to Hypertensive neuropathy (damage of the nerve fibers).

However, other causes need to be ruled out, such as:
1. Poor neuromuscular co-ordination.
2. Any fluctuation in blood sugar levels
3. Nerve compression due to incorrect sleeping posture
4. Inadequate hydration & nutrition status.
5. Deficiency of certain nutrients like Iron, Vitamin B 12, Calcium, Magnesium, etc.

Investigations like complete blood count, serum electrolytes, estimation of blood pressure and blood sugar levels, & Doppler scan of the arm will be helpful in clinching the diagnosis.

Symptomatic relief can be obtained with nervigenic agents (like Vit B6, B12, Folic acid) as well as multivitamin & mineral supplementation needs to be added in the diet.

If symptoms still persist, kindly consult a Neurologist for a proper clinical examination.
